71 /*
72  * UDP kernel structures and variables.
73  */
74 struct  udpiphdr {
75 	struct  ipovly ui_i;            /* overlaid ip structure */
76 	struct  udphdr ui_u;            /* udp header */
77 };
78 #define ui_x1           ui_i.ih_x1
79 #define ui_pr           ui_i.ih_pr
80 #define ui_len          ui_i.ih_len
81 #define ui_src          ui_i.ih_src
82 #define ui_dst          ui_i.ih_dst
83 #define ui_sport        ui_u.uh_sport
84 #define ui_dport        ui_u.uh_dport
85 #define ui_ulen         ui_u.uh_ulen
86 #define ui_sum          ui_u.uh_sum
87 #define ui_next         ui_i.ih_next
88 #define ui_prev         ui_i.ih_prev
89 
90 struct  udpstat {
91 	/* input statistics: */
92 	u_int32_t udps_ipackets;        /* total input packets */
93 	u_int32_t udps_hdrops;          /* packet shorter than header */
94 	u_int32_t udps_badsum;          /* checksum error */
95 	u_int32_t udps_badlen;          /* data length larger than packet */
96 	u_int32_t udps_noport;          /* no socket on port */
97 	u_int32_t udps_noportbcast;     /* of above, arrived as broadcast */
98 	u_int32_t udps_fullsock;        /* not delivered, input socket full */
99 	u_int32_t udpps_pcbcachemiss;   /* input packets missing pcb cache */
100 	u_int32_t udpps_pcbhashmiss;    /* input packets not for hashed pcb */
101 	/* output statistics: */
102 	u_int32_t udps_opackets;        /* total output packets */
103 	u_int32_t udps_fastout;         /* output packets on fast path */
104 	u_int32_t udps_nosum;           /* no checksum */
105 	u_int32_t udps_noportmcast;     /* of no socket on port, multicast */
106 	u_int32_t udps_filtermcast;     /* blocked by multicast filter */
107 	/* checksum statistics: */
108 	u_int32_t udps_rcv_swcsum;        /* udp swcksum (inbound), packets */
109 	u_int32_t udps_rcv_swcsum_bytes;  /* udp swcksum (inbound), bytes */
110 	u_int32_t udps_rcv6_swcsum;       /* udp6 swcksum (inbound), packets */
111 	u_int32_t udps_rcv6_swcsum_bytes; /* udp6 swcksum (inbound), bytes */
112 	u_int32_t udps_snd_swcsum;        /* udp swcksum (outbound), packets */
113 	u_int32_t udps_snd_swcsum_bytes;  /* udp swcksum (outbound), bytes */
114 	u_int32_t udps_snd6_swcsum;       /* udp6 swcksum (outbound), packets */
115 	u_int32_t udps_snd6_swcsum_bytes; /* udp6 swcksum (outbound), bytes */
116 };
117 
118 /*
119  * Names for UDP sysctl objects
120  */
121 #define UDPCTL_CHECKSUM         1       /* checksum UDP packets */
122 #define UDPCTL_STATS            2       /* statistics (read-only) */
123 #define UDPCTL_MAXDGRAM         3       /* max datagram size */
124 #define UDPCTL_RECVSPACE        4       /* default receive buffer space */
125 #define UDPCTL_PCBLIST          5       /* list of PCBs for UDP sockets */
126 #define UDPCTL_MAXID            6
